TED ROGERS JR 1933-2008
Edward Samuel "Ted" Rogers, Jr., OC, BA, LL.B, D.Sc (born May 27, 1933 in Toronto, Ontario, died December 2, 2008, in Toronto) was the President and CEO of Rogers Communications Inc., and the richest person in
Canada in terms of net worth. His father Edward S. Rogers, Sr. is regarded as the founder of the company, although the radio station that he founded is now owned by another Canadian company competitor Astral Media.
